The Konjo of Congo, Democratic Republic of the

The Konjo of Congo, Democratic Republic of the, numbering approximately 398,000 people, are Engaged yet Unreached. They are an indigenous community of Congo (Kinshasa). They are an Indigenous people, in the Bantu, Central-Lakes people cluster of the Sub-Saharan African Peoples affinity bloc. Their primary religion is Christianity - Roman Catholicism. They primarily speak Konzo.
